David Posted September 5, 2018 Share Posted September 5, 2018 I know we have a thread on TV, but wanted something specific to Netflix only, I can’t be the only one that doesn’t bother with Amazon Prime and Sky Boxsets. Coming to the end of Season 2 of Ozark and need some suggestions of where to go next. Before I go on, Ozark. For those that haven’t seen it has the Breaking Bad feel to it, just your normal neighbourhood bloke getting into business you wouldn’t expect. Not drugs this time but money laundering. First season was great, second season I’m torn on, but as it’s been out less than a week I won’t post any spoilers. With 3 episodes left myself and all I will say is it feels like they are putting in a bit too much drama if that makes sense. It has me hooked still, only started it yesterday and smashed through 7 episodes but with the “oh yeah, here we go again” feeling. Whilst I’m here, if you are into your everyday man getting into dodgy businsss, Good Girls is worth a watch, as the title would suggest it’s a female version. A bit slapsticky but it’s easy going, will give you a few laughs whilst holding on to a decent enough storyline. Full credit to srg for putting me on to that. Chuck your Netflix recommendations in here, tell us what you’re watching and whilst it’s open for everyone so I don’t have to go through the initial first posts telling me to watch [insert seen it], here is a list of what I have seen. Breaking Bad, Homeland, Sons of Anarchy, Mad Men, Suits, Ozark, The Sinner, Safe, Mindhunter, Manhunt:Unabomber, White Gold, Stranger Things, The Mist, Better Call Saul, Good Girls. All of which are worth a watch if people haven’t, but I would leave Stranger Things and The Mist down the bottom of your list or when you want something a bit cheesy/nostalgic. Gaspode Posted September 5, 2018 Share Posted September 5, 2018 Shooter is worth a watch - far fetched, indestructible hero, conspiracies everywhere - but normally entertaining (in a 'switch your brain off and enjoy' sort of way)..... Also, if you don't mind the more adult Marvel series, Jessica Jones is good and the Punisher is excellent (though again, indestructible hero and large dollops of OTT violence) - Daredevil is pretty good as well - Luke Cage is cheesy and has some atrocious acting and Iron Fist is a bit crap (but that may just be that I have an urge to punch the lead character....) Designated Survivor was a great idea, but as it moves on, it seems they want to combine a Homeland style conspiracy programme with a soap opera (also, has some of the worst examples of 'British' characters, with awful plummy accents - do Yanks really think we all talk like that?) If you can stomach watching Spacey after the recent revelations, the US version of House of Cards was well done (though they should have quit before the last series) Recently started on Travelers - only 3 episodes in, but seems promising....
